Job Description:

Ensures the active and informed engagement of the foundation's board, its committees, and region and campus executives in securing charitable investments to advance the hospital's strategic goals and operational priorities. Collaborates with institutional leadership and the board to establish realistic annual financial goals based on the hospital's strategic priorities. Focuses on relationship-based giving from individuals and businesses through major, planned, and blended gifts. Works with hospital leadership and the foundation's board to identify, engage, cultivate, solicit, and steward prospects and donors. Collaborates with finance department to ensure accurate documentation, fiscal management, and accountability. Records all donor activity in software management system and ensures all donations are reconciled using management system and other software tools. Ensures prompt and accurate donor acknowledgment and recognition. Provides reports to the board and executive leadership on the foundation's goals, progress, challenges, and opportunities. Collaborates, supports, and plans annual giving opportunities to acquire, renew, and upgrade donors through various channels. Develops the foundation's promotional plans and materials in collaboration with other regional foundations and teams to ensure alignment with brand standards. Presents the foundation's information and updates to campus leadership and new employees. Directs the foundation's board in identifying, engaging, and orienting volunteer board members to meet the foundation's goals. Other duties as assigned.
